1、从单个接口的 test_.py 模块开始写。
2、实现数据驱动 DDT
3、读取Excel, ExcelHandler 类, 存放在 common 包里面
4、分层,数据,配置文件,logger 日志记录,测试报告。
5、注册、登陆。 数据动态生成,手机号码 faker.phone_number()
6、数据库存在,为了节省开发成本,是可以不做数据库校验
7、数据库的操作
8、数据替换,excel #exsit_phone#, if 写得有点多,实现的代码简单容易理解,只有一点
笨拙。
9、正则表达式,更加优雅,更加具有技术含量。
10、断言,全量断言,单一字段断言,多字段断言。
11、充值接口,接口依赖。获取 token, Bearer token, JWT token
12、前置条件,pytest fixture, 有多少前置,就得写多少 fixture,
13、审核用例、投资用例。 excel 当中把依赖的接口写在前面。一般在excel 当中
会有extractor, 数据提取。:不需要频繁编写代码,只需要配置excel 文件就可以了。
14、middleHandler, 中间层。1、调用起来非常方便,代码看起来更加简洁。
15、简化 common 包中模块的调用。
接口自动化测试编写代码的流程
猜你喜欢
转载自blog.csdn.net/weixin_48580001/article/details/115252752
今日推荐
周排行